Several Japanese films and documentaries have been produced based on the tragedy. The most notable are Joshikôsei konkuriito-dume satsujin-jiken (1995) and Concrete (2004). Clips from these fictional, acted movies are frequently re-uploaded online and falsely labeled as "real footage." video de junko furuta video real

: Malicious websites frequently exploit highly searched true crime keywords. Clicking on links that promise a "real video" of the case poses severe security threats, including malware infection, phishing schemes, and data theft.
